The Japan Automotive Ceramics Market is a robust and growing sector driven by the increasing demand for advanced materials in the automotive industry. Automotive ceramics are widely used in various applications such as catalytic converters, sensors, engine components, and electronic control units due to their superior thermal and mechanical properties. The market in Japan is characterized by the presence of key players like Kyocera Corporation, NGK Insulators Ltd., and CoorsTek Inc., who are continuously investing in research and development to innovate new products. The market is expected to witness steady growth in the coming years, fueled by the rising adoption of electric vehicles and stringent emission regulations, which require advanced ceramics for pollution control. Additionally, the focus on lightweight and fuel-efficient vehicles is further driving the demand for automotive ceramics in Japan.

In the Japan Automotive Ceramics Market, one of the main challenges faced is the competition from other advanced materials like metals and polymers. Automotive ceramics are known for their high heat resistance, hardness, and electrical insulation properties, but they are often more expensive to produce compared to traditional materials. This cost factor can be a barrier to adoption by automotive manufacturers who are constantly seeking cost-effective solutions. Additionally, the delicate nature of ceramic components makes them more prone to breakage during manufacturing or assembly processes, leading to higher rejection rates and increased production costs. The industry also faces challenges in developing innovative ceramic materials that can meet the evolving performance requirements of next-generation vehicles while maintaining cost competitiveness.
